Key Steps for a Smooth Transition to the Cloud
Effective cloud migration involves several important steps to ensure a seamless process. Start with a data audit to classify information based on its importance and sensitivity. Next, prioritize migrating less critical systems to identify any issues early in the process. Automation tools can accelerate migration and reduce human error, while thorough testing post-migration verifies data integrity and system performance. Ongoing monitoring after the transition supports continuous optimization and troubleshooting.
